With the white balance dial in the preset white
balance position, press the white-balance button to
open the setting screen.

The up/down controller keys adjust the white balance in seven levels: +3 to –3 (+4 to –2
for fluorescent). Except for fluorescent, the change of one unit is approximately equal to
a 10 mired shift.

Use the left/right controller keys or control
dial to select the white-balance setting.

The up/down controller keys shift the white-
balance, see below.

Press the central controller button to
complete the operation.

For more information on light sources, see page 69.

Daylight - for outdoor sunlit subjects.

Shade - for subjects illuminated by skylight: shady conditions on a clear day.

Cloudy - for cloudy or overcast outdoor conditions.

Flash - for electronic flash.

Tungsten - for incandescent lighting: household filament light bulbs.

Fluorescent - for fluorescent lighting: office ceiling lights.
